L'Expansion Stratégique de Superprof : L'Incursion du Brésil sur le Marché des Tutorats en Ligne
L'acquisition récente par Superprof d'une plateforme brésilienne marque une étape significative dans sa stratégie d'expansion internationale. Cette initiative positionne l'entreprise non seulement comme un acteur majeur du marché européen, mais aussi comme un acteur incontournable dans le paysage éducatif numérique en Amérique du Sud. Pour les consultants IT spécialisés dans les systèmes d'information et le cloud, cette opération révèle des enjeux cruciaux en matière d'intégration technique, de conformité réglementaire et de scalabilité des infrastructures.
En bref
- Objectif stratégique : Accéder au marché en pleine croissance du tutorat en ligne au Brésil, un marché caractérisé par une forte demande éducative numérique.
- Enjeux techniques : Intégration des systèmes, harmonisation des plateformes, gestion de la latence et de la bande passante pour une expérience utilisateur optimale.
- Défis réglementaires : Naviguer dans les spécificités légales et fiscales propres au secteur de l'éducation et des paiements dans le pays cible.
- Opportunités pour les consultants : Mise en place d'infrastructures cloud robustes, sécurisation des données (RGPD/lois locales), et optimisation de l'expérience utilisateur (UX) multilingue.
1. L'Architecture Technique : Harmonisation et Scalabilité Transfrontalière
L'intégration d'une nouvelle entité, surtout dans un secteur aussi sensible que l'éducation en ligne, nécessite une approche architecturale rigoureuse. Il ne s'agit pas seulement de migrer des données, mais de créer une plateforme unifiée capable de gérer des volumes de trafic et des exigences locales spécifiques.
1.1. Choix de l'Infrastructure Cloud pour la Latence
Pour garantir une expérience fluide aux utilisateurs brésiliens, la localisation des ressources de calcul est primordiale. Une stratégie de déploiement multi-régions est indispensable.
- Stratégie de déploiement : Utilisation de fournisseurs de cloud offrant une présence solide au Brésil (ex. AWS São Paulo, Google Cloud Brazil).
- Conteneurisation : Adopter des conteneurs (Docker/Kubernetes) pour assurer une portabilité et une mise à l'échelle rapides des services critiques (gestion des cours, vidéoconférence).
- Optimisation du CDN : Mise en place d'un réseau de diffusion de contenu (CDN) robuste pour minimiser la latence de streaming vidéo, essentiel pour les sessions de tutorat en direct.
Exemple de configuration (Conceptuel Kubernetes/Terraform) :
# Extrait de configuration Terraform pour le déploiement régional
resource "aws_vpc" "br_vpc" {
cidr_block = "10.0.0.0/16"
tags = {
Name = "Superprof-BR-Prod-VPC"
}
}
resource "aws_eks_cluster" "br_cluster" {
name = "superprof-br-cluster"
role_arn = aws_iam_role.eks_node.arn
version = "1.28"
vpc_config {
subnet_ids = [aws_subnet.br_public.id, aws_subnet.br_private.id]
}
}
1.2. Intégration des Systèmes et API Gateway
L'intégration des systèmes existants (gestion des utilisateurs, paiement, contenu pédagogique) doit passer par une couche d'API Gateway sécurisée. Ceci permet d'isoler le système local des systèmes globaux tout en assurant une communication fluide.
- Microservices vs. Monolithe : Privilégier une architecture de microservices pour permettre une mise à jour indépendante des modules spécifiques au marché brésilien (ex. intégration des méthodes de paiement locales).
- API Gateway : Utilisation d'une passerelle API (ex. Kong, AWS API Gateway) pour gérer l'authentification (OAuth 2.0/JWT) et la limitation de débit (rate limiting) spécifique aux requêtes venant du Brésil.
- Interopérabilité des données : Mise en place d'un schéma de données commun (schema management) pour assurer que les données échangées entre la plateforme mère et la nouvelle entité respectent les standards de qualité et de sécurité.
2. Sécurité et Conformité : Naviguer entre Réglementations
L'expansion internationale expose l'entreprise à un éventail complexe de régulations. La sécurité des données personnelles (notamment celles des mineurs, si applicable) et la conformité aux lois fiscales locales sont des piliers non négociables.
2.1. Cybersécurité et Protection des Données (LGPD vs. GDPR)
Le Brésil dispose de sa propre législation sur la protection des données (LGPD), qui, bien que similaire au RGPD européen, impose des exigences spécifiques en matière de stockage et de transfert de données.
- Chiffrement des Données (Data at Rest & In Transit) : Application stricte du chiffrement de bout en bout. Utilisation de KMS (Key Management Service) pour gérer les clés de chiffrement, avec des politiques de rétention adaptées aux exigences locales.
- Gestion des Accès (IAM) : Implémentation du principe du moindre privilège (Least Privilege). Définition de rôles et de politiques d'accès granulaires pour les équipes opérationnelles locales.
- Audit et Monitoring : Mise en place de systèmes de surveillance (SIEM) capables de détecter les anomalies spécifiques aux tentatives d'accès ou de fuite de données dans le contexte brésilien.
Configuration de la politique de chiffrement (Exemple IAM/Cloud) :
# Exemple de configuration de politique IAM pour restreindre l'accès aux données sensibles
aws iam put-role-policy \
--role-name "SuperprofBRDataProcessor" \
--policy-name "DataAccessPolicy" \
--policy-document '{
"Version": "2012-10-17",
"Statement": [
{
"Effect": "Deny",
"Action": "s3:GetObject",
"Resource": "arn:aws:s3:::superprof-br-data/*",
"Condition": {
"StringNotLike": {
"aws:PrincipalTag/Region": "BR_Operations"
}
}
}
]
}'
2.2. Conformité Fiscale et Paiement (Payment Gateways)
La gestion des transactions financières doit être conforme aux normes bancaires brésiliennes et aux exigences fiscales locales (ex. taxes de vente spécifiques).
- Intégration des PSP Locaux : Évaluation et intégration de passerelles de paiement locales pour optimiser les taux de conversion et la conformité fiscale.
- Séparation des Données Financières : S'assurer que les données de paiement sont traitées par des systèmes certifiés PCI DSS (si applicable) et isolées des données personnelles non financières.
3. Optimisation de l'Expérience Utilisateur (UX) et Localisation
La réussite sur un marché local dépend intrinsèquement de l'adaptation de l'expérience utilisateur. Cela va au-delà de la simple traduction ; il s'agit d'une localisation culturelle et linguistique profonde.
3.1. Stratégie de Localisation Multilingue et Culturelle
Le contenu, l'interface et le support client doivent résonner avec la culture brésilienne.
- Traduction Contextuelle : Utiliser des ressources humaines locales pour valider la terminologie. Une traduction littérale est souvent inefficace dans le contexte éducatif.
- Adaptation des Processus : Ajuster les flux d'inscription, les modalités de tarification et les processus de support client pour correspondre aux attentes locales. Par exemple, les méthodes de paiement préférées ou les horaires de support.
- Optimisation Mobile-First : Étant donné la pénétration élevée des smartphones, l'application mobile doit être prioritaire. Assurer une performance rapide même sur des connexions mobiles moins stables.
3.2. Performance et Résilience du Service
L'infrastructure doit être conçue pour résister aux pics de demande inattendus, typiques des plateformes éducatives populaires.
- Load Balancing Avancé : Configuration de mécanismes de répartition de charge intelligents pour distribuer le trafic sur plusieurs zones géographiques au sein du Brésil.
- Monitoring Proactif : Mise en place de tableaux de bord (dashboards) consolidés (Prometheus/Grafana) pour surveiller en temps réel la latence, le taux d'erreur et la saturation des ressources, permettant une intervention préventive.
Commande d'optimisation de la performance (Monitoring) :
# Exemple de configuration d'alerte dans Prometheus pour la latence de la base de données
# Ceci surveille la latence des requêtes critiques du service de matching des tuteurs
ALERT DatabaseLatencyHigh
IF (avg_over_time(histogram_quantile(0.99, rate(http_request_duration_seconds_bucket{service="tutor_matching_service"}[5m]))) > 500)
FOR 5m
LABELS {
severity = "critical"
}
ANNOTATIONS {
summary = "Latence de la base de données critique dépasse 500ms sur le service de matching."
description = "Vérifier les requêtes lentes vers le cluster de données régional."
}
## Bonnes pratiques pour consultants IT
En tant que consultants accompagnant cette expansion, votre rôle est de traduire la stratégie business en architecture technique robuste et conforme.
- Audit de la Dette Technique Existante : Avant toute intégration, évaluer la dette technique de la plateforme acquise. Identifier les points de friction qui pourraient ralentir l'intégration ou compromettre la performance.
- Priorisation de la Conformité (Compliance First) : Ne jamais considérer la conformité (LGPD, fiscales) comme une étape secondaire. Intégrez les exigences légales dès la phase de conception (Security by Design).
- Adopter une Mentalité DevOps/SRE : Pour gérer la complexité multi-régionale, adoptez des pratiques DevOps pour automatiser le déploiement, le monitoring et la réponse aux incidents. L'infrastructure doit être auto-réparatrice.
- Gestion des Dépendances : Cartographier précisément toutes les dépendances techniques (services tiers, APIs externes, systèmes de paiement) pour éviter les ruptures de service lors des changements régionaux.
- Investir dans l'Automatisation du Déploiement (IaC) : Utiliser des outils comme Terraform ou Ansible pour garantir que l'infrastructure de production au Brésil soit une réplique exacte et reproductible de l'architecture définie.
## Points Clés à Retenir
- Architecture Distribuée : Nécessité d'une architecture cloud multi-régionale pour minimiser la latence.
- Sécurité Hybride : Application rigoureuse des standards de sécurité globaux tout en respectant les spécificités de la LGPD.
- Localisation Profonde : L'UX et le contenu doivent être adaptés culturellement, pas seulement linguistiquement.
- Observabilité Critique : Des outils de monitoring robustes sont essentiels pour détecter rapidement les problèmes de performance spécifiques à la nouvelle région.
- Agilité d'Intégration : Utiliser des patterns d'intégration (API Gateway, Microservices) pour permettre une intégration rapide sans compromettre la stabilité du cœur de métier.
Source : Maddyness